Today I went to Meijer. I started to walk, as it was bright and sunny and such mild temps – perfect for a walk, but I decided to just take the car and walk laps in the store to add to my total mileage. Unless the weather turns ugly tomorrow I should reach 500 miles, so I am keeping my fingers crossed as the time is dwindling to get it done in 2013. A Facebook friend posted that she has already received three seed catalogs in the mail. Well, on a balmy day like today Summer and planting time does not seem crazy at all.

I hadn’t been to Meijer since the first week of December when the aisles were full of Christmas goodies and trinkets, all which have been moved and marked down to make room for the New Year’s Eve fare, festive disposable dinnerware and noisemakers. The large Christmas décor area was nearly bare and soon the shelves will be stocked with Slim Fast and exercise equipment as incentives for our potential New Year’s resolutions. Then, the diet aids will soon be followed by paper shredders, income tax software and calculators so we can tackle the income tax project later in the season.

Walking around the store I heard a cacophony of coughs, sneezes and alot of sniffling as well. Since I’m a bit of a germaphobe, I was glad to walk the outer perimeter, then fill my cart up with my grocery items and beat a hasty retreat. ‘Tis the tail end of the holidays but unfortunately it is also the onset of flu season, so I hope that flu shot and all my apples and oranges work their magic and I stay healthy.

It sure was great to see the sun shining, wasn’t it? It actually made you forget about the big snowfall two weeks ago today and the torrential all-day rain, just last Saturday. The wacky weather continues, but for a Winter wienie like me, I could take today’s weather anytime as we ease into Spring!
